Source: Walter Hermance

The Rainbow theater was located directly across the street on Grand River from the Rivera theater. In the forties my friends and I attended movies a few times a year. I don't know when it was closed, sometime in the fifties I would think.

4/4/2006 - Tom Seller
About 1939 or 1940 the Rainbo must have attained its greatest audience when it presented the then-notorious "Ecstasy" starring Hedy Keisler (better known later as Hedy Lamarr). The Czech film, from 1932, reputed to show nude shots of Hedy, was a rerelease with added narration (it was originally silent). Just how graphic the rerelease was I cannot say. I was just eight years old at the time but I can still remember the long lines of patrons waiting to be admitted to the next showing.
